Data Mover admite Teradata Data Stream Architecture (DSA), y viene empaquetado con ella, para copiar bases y tablas entre sistemas Teradata.
Los siguientes componentes forman parte de las características de DSA. Es importante conocer cuáles son los componentes que necesitan instalación y configuración antes de usar la utilidad DSA de Data Mover:
Componente | Descripción |
---|---|
Controlador de flujo de datos (DSC) | El DSC controla todas las operaciones de copias de seguridad y recuperaciones (BAR) y está empaquetado e instalado con el daemon de Data Mover. Puede usar la utilidad DSA de Data Mover con un DSC externo o con el DSC empaquetado. Consulte Guía de instalación, configuración y actualización de Teradata® Data Mover para clientes para obtener más información. |
DSMAIN | DSMAIN se ejecuta en los nodos de Teradata Database y recibe los planes de trabajo de DSC. Es necesario configurar y habilitar DSMAIN antes de comunicarse con el DSC de Data Mover para ejecutar trabajos. DSMAIN está instalado en las versiones 14.10 y posteriores de Teradata Database. Consulte Guía de instalación, configuración y actualización de Teradata® Data Mover para clientes para obtener información sobre la configuración y la habilitación de sistemas de origen y destino para trabajar con el DSC de Data Mover. |
Cliente de red de DSA | También conocido como cliente de red de BAR (al que se hace referencia como NC de BAR o ClientHandler). El cliente de red de DSA copia datos del DSMAIN de origen al DSMAIN de destino usando canales de datos de redes compartidas. Los servidores que tienen instalado y configurado el software de cliente de red de DSA también se conocen como servidores de medios. Cuando se usa la utilidad DSA de Data Mover, se recomienda elegir la Teradata Database de origen o de destino como el servidor de medios para obtener un rendimiento óptimo. Consulte Guía de instalación, configuración y actualización de Teradata® Data Mover para clientes para obtener información sobre la instalación y la configuración del cliente de red de DSA. |
Interfaz de línea de comandos de DSA (CLI) | La interfaz de línea de comandos de DSA proporciona comandos para definir la configuración de DSA y está empaquetada e instalada con el daemon de Data Mover. |
Reglas y restricciones
- La utilidad DSA de Data Mover requiere una configuración adicional antes de usarla.
- Si existe un DSA externo designado para la aplicación de copia de seguridad y restauración en el entorno, y desea utilizar la utilidad DSA de Data Mover, debe actualizar los componentes de DSA externos existentes (incluidos DSC y NC de BAR) para que coincidan con la versión de la utilidad DSA de Data Mover.
- Las siguientes restricciones son verdaderas cuando un sistema de origen o de destino contiene versiones de Teradata Database anteriores a la 16.00 y la utilidad DSA de Data Mover se usa para copiar datos:
- La base de datos no funciona con más de un entorno de DSC a la vez. La siguiente tabla muestra los errores que se pueden producir cuando dos DSC usan el mismo sistema de Teradata Database que son versiones anteriores a la 16.00:
Escenario Resultado El entorno de BAR de DSA ya existe en el sistema Un entorno de Data Mover con el DSC empaquetado está instalado y se ejecutan los siguientes trabajos: - Un trabajo de copia de seguridad de BAR desde el sistema A.
- Un trabajo de DSA de Data Mover para copiar datos del sistema A al sistema B.
Existen dos entornos de Data Mover: prueba y producción Los dos entornos de Data Mover tienen un DSC empaquetado y se ejecutan los siguientes trabajos: - Un trabajo de DSA de Data Mover en el entorno de prueba de Data Mover copiando datos del sistema A al sistema B.
- Un trabajo de DSA de Data Mover en el entorno de producción de Data Mover copiando datos del sistema B al sistema C.
Hay un entorno de Data Mover con compatibilidad para conmutación por error automática que consta de un daemon de Data Mover activo y otro en espera Tanto el daemon de Data Mover activo como el daemon en espera se configuran con un DSC empaquetado y la conmutación por error se produce después de la ejecución del siguiente trabajo: - Trabajo de DSA de Data Mover en el daemon de Data Mover activo copiando datos del sistema A al sistema B.
- DSA no se elige de forma automática para la base de datos de origen o destino cuando no se especifica force_utility en la definición del trabajo. Para los usuarios avanzados que comprenden estas restricciones y desean usar la utilidad DSA de Data Mover para copiar datos a bases de datos anteriores, se debe especificar DSA como force_utility.
- La base de datos no funciona con más de un entorno de DSC a la vez. La siguiente tabla muestra los errores que se pueden producir cuando dos DSC usan el mismo sistema de Teradata Database que son versiones anteriores a la 16.00: